The 10-foot-tall replica of the gilded fence, known as the «Grille Royale» that was torn down and melted after the 1789 revolution.
 

When first built, the fence around the royal domain of Versailles was 43 kilometers in length. Before the revolution, the gardens and woods of Versailles covered 8,000 hectares, this area today is 875 hectares.
